Gutter Cleaning
1. Prevents Water Overflow: Gutters that are clogged with leaves, twigs, or debris can’t channel water properly. This can lead to overflow, causing water to damage your roof, fascia, and foundation.
2. Protects Your Foundation: Overflowing gutters can result in water pooling around your foundation, potentially causing leaks or cracks.
3. Reduces the Risk of Pests: Clogged gutters create a perfect breeding ground for insects, rodents, and even mold. Keeping your gutters clear helps avoid these issues.
4. Prevents Roof Damage: Water that overflows from clogged gutters can seep into your roof structure, leading to rot and other long-term damage.
How Often Should You Clean?
• Roof Cleaning: It’s typically recommended to clean your roof once a year, but this depends on the type of roof, climate, and environmental conditions. If you have a lot of trees around your home, you may need to clean it more frequently.
• Gutter Cleaning: You should clean your gutters at least twice a year—once in the spring and once in the fall. If you live in a heavily wooded area, more frequent cleanings might be needed.
Safety Considerations
Roof and gutter cleaning can be dangerous, especially if you need to use a ladder or work on steep slopes. If you’re not comfortable doing it yourself, it’s best to hire a professional roofing service to ensure the job is done safely and correctly.
